Regular Circuit Breaker Tripping
While a tripped breaker can seem routine, frequent trips point to a load imbalance, faulty wiring, or a failing breaker that necessitates a professional inspection. The issue likely involves circuit overloads, a short to ground, or a loose neutral. Repeated resets heat terminals, degrade insulation, and mask underlying hazards. Never replace a higher-amp breaker or "DIY fix" the panel; that violates code and raises fire risk.
A licensed Downers Grove electrician will verify panel labeling, assess loads per NEC Article 220, conduct torque tests on lugs to spec, and conduct breaker maintenance: test trip curves, assess bus stabs, and replace weak breakers. Your electrician will map circuits, separate dedicated loads (climate control systems, microwaves), and redistribute branch circuits to balance phases. If required, the electrician will install AFCI/GFCI protection and advise on a service upgrade.
Lights That Flicker or Appear Dim
Spot flickers or dimming and drill down to the cause before it turns hazardous. When lights flicker, don't ignore the signal. Verify lamp type and LED compatibility with existing dimmers; mismatched controls cause strobing. Next, check for voltage fluctuation: do lights dip when a motor loads (air conditioning, microwave)? That indicates undersized circuits, loose neutrals, or service drop issues. Inspect for over-lamping-bulb wattage must not exceed fixture ratings. Ensure tight, listed connections at switches, fixtures, and wirenuts; heat-cycled terminations loosen over time. Look for evenly balanced loads across phases; imbalance will dim some circuits and brighten others. If symptoms persist across rooms, call a licensed Downers Grove electrician to measure line voltage, test neutrals, tighten terminations, and correct panel or service defects.
Warm Outlets or Odors
Flickering lights aren't the sole indicator; heat and odors around devices demand faster action. When you notice a heated outlet, discontinue use immediately and remove the plug. A socket must maintain room temperature with standard electrical flow. Heat points to poor wire contact, excessive circuit load, backstabbed connections, or failing devices. A burning odor indicates insulation breakdown or arcing—each presenting fire risks. Never continuously reset tripped breakers; this conceals underlying problems.
Do a quick check: gently check the plates, listen for buzzing, look for discoloration or melted plastic, and verify plug prongs aren't scorched. Stay away from extension-cord daisy chains and excessive wattage loads on shared circuits. Call a licensed Downers Grove electrician to assess conductors, tighten lugs to torque specs, inspect receptacles, and fix code violations with AFCI/GFCI protection as mandated.

Expert Lighting Installations
Spanning kitchen installations to patio setups, proper lighting starts with load calculations, proper conductor sizing, and listed fixtures designed for the environment. You'll get luminaires designated for moisture-prone locations outdoors, and insulation-contact and airtight housings where insulation is present. We check switch leg routing, grounding connections, and required circuit protection as mandated by electrical code. For LED retrofits, we choose compatible dimmers, confirm driver ratings, and maintain correct wattage specifications.
We strategize pendant placements with proper spacing over islands and tables, check box fill, and use secure support for heavy fixtures. Recessed layouts comply with spacing-to-height ratios to prevent glare and shadows. Exterior lighting uses sealed connections, in-use covers, and timer or photocell control with appropriate overcurrent protection. Before energizing, we check polarity, continuity, and function to confirm safe, even illumination.

Improvements: Electric Vehicle Chargers, Intelligent Panels, and Surge Protection
Durable commercial systems establish the baseline; next, you enhance infrastructure with targeted upgrades: EV charging circuits, smart load centers, and whole-home or facility surge protection. You commence by sizing service capacity, then dedicate circuits for Level 2 EV chargers with appropriate conductor gauge, GFCI where required, load calculations per NEC Article 220, and labeling for future maintenance. You designate listed equipment, proper ventilation clearances, and networked monitoring for usage analytics and cost reduction.
Smart load centers add real-time click here metering, remote shedding, and arc-fault/ground-fault protection. You establish load priorities, demand limits, and firmware updates on a secure VLAN. For surge protection, you deploy Type 1 SPD at the service and Type 2 at subpanels, bond grounding electrodes, reduce lead length, and verify let-through ratings match equipment tolerances.
